Transaction 51d8a90d84fd76dede4c56dd342c5a4886d567c1d43fb2b19617b87615500341

1 Input
2 Outputs
  • 51d8a90d84fd76dede4c56dd342c5a4886d567c1d43fb2b19617b87615500341:0
  • value  2895890
    address  32LXFtVNpJyEHHgoYURDpQCK9Cp6QK1ufg
  • 51d8a90d84fd76dede4c56dd342c5a4886d567c1d43fb2b19617b87615500341:1
  • value  46922421
    address  3NuB84kvM4v1pud3JLkfGF8B3ezrK8vCYa